Food Technology

The Food Technology course at Tumaini Innovational Center equips students with essential knowledge and practical skills in food processing, preservation, quality control, and safety. Learners are introduced to food science principles, modern production techniques, and hygiene standards required to handle and prepare food in line with industry regulations. Through both classroom instruction and hands-on training, students gain experience in transforming raw ingredients into safe, nutritious, and market-ready products.

This program not only builds technical competence but also nurtures creativity, problem-solving, and entrepreneurial skills for those aspiring to venture into the food industry. Graduates are well-prepared to work in food manufacturing companies, hospitality institutions, research labs, or even establish their own food processing businesses. With its strong balance of theory and practice, the Food Technology course provides a solid pathway for a rewarding and innovative career in the food sector.
